The Dandy Warhols Announce ‘Distortland’ Australian Tour -October 2016
In 1994 a groovy little band outta Portland, Oregon burst into life – they were called THE DANDY WARHOLS. There were a group of friends who ’needed music to drink to’. For the last two decades, THE DANDY WARHOLS have solidified themselves as a veteran rock act that combine a detached garage rock cool with effervescent pop melodies, creating a sound that has been described as Portland’s answer to Brit-Pop.

Ozomatli Announces Australian East Coast Tour – October 2016
Time to get those dancing shoes ready – we have a real treat for you!
Grammy-winning Californian groove makers OZOMATLI will be heading back down under later this year for a tour of the East Coast, bringing a full live band and epic set of hits that feature their signature sound combination of Latin salsa, urban hip-hop and jazz-funk.
